Abstract
Medical data mining is the method of collecting, examining and interpreting the health information for improving the patient care and support decision-making. Medical data processing comprised the data collection, storage, analysis and prediction. Diabetes is a chronic condition characterized by impaired glucose metabolism. Diabetes poses the significant global health challenge. Diabetes resulted in chronic damage and dysfunction of different tissues like eyes, kidneys, heart, blood vessels and nerves. Diabetes prediction has received large research interest to emphasize the importance of predicting diabetes for early intervention and management strategies. Data pre-processing is the process of handling the missing the data points from input dataset. Feature selection is the process of selecting the relevant features from input database. With the selected features, the patient data classification is carried out. Different researchers carried out their research on different diabetes disease detection. But, the accuracy level was not enhanced and time complexity was not reduced. In order to address these issues, machine learning and deep learning based diabetic disease diagnosis is discussed in the survey article.
